WDFY1 Break Apart FISH Probe
Empire Genomics’ WDFY1 Break Apart FISH Probe is designed to flank the WDFY1 gene and is typically used for detecting WDFY1 rearrangements such as translocations. This probe is FISH confirmed on normal peripheral blood metaphase spreads and interphase nuclei. The probe comes labeled in green and orange by default, but may be customized to meet your needs.

Gene Summary
The protein encoded by this gene is a phosphatidylinositol 3-phosphate binding protein, which contains a FYVE zinc finger domain and multiple WD-40 repeat domains. When exogenously expressed, it localizes to early endosomes. Mutagenesis analysis demonstrates that this endosomal localization is mediated by the FYVE domain. [provided by RefSeq, Jan 2015]
Gene Details
Gene Symbol: WDFY1
Gene Name: WD Repeat And FYVE Domain Containing 1
Chromosome: CHR2: 224740064-224810052
Locus: 2q36.1
